What is Low-Level Laser Light Therapy (LLLT)?
LLLT is a non-invasive treatment that uses low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es (LEDs) to stimulate hair growth. Unlike the high-power lasers used in surgery, LLLT is gentle and safe. It doesn’t cause any pain, and there’s no downtime, which makes it a popular choice.
This treatment works by shining laser light on the scalp. The light is absorbed by the hair follicles, which increases blood flow and boosts cell activity. As a result, the hair follicles become stronger and more active, which can lead to thicker, healthier hair over time.
How Effective is LLLT?
Many people have seen positive results with LLLT. It is especially helpful for those in the early stages of hair thinning or mild to moderate hair loss. Studies have shown that it can improve hair density and reduce hair shedding. However, it’s important to have realistic expectations.
LLLT is not a miracle cure. It does not work overnight, and it won’t regrow hair for everyone. Most people need several sessions over a few months before they notice visible changes. The results are also better when the treatment is combined with other hair restoration methods, like P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) therapy or medications.
Is LLLT Safe?
Yes, LLLT is considered very safe. There are no serious side effects reported. Some people might feel a slight warmth on their scalp during the session, but it is usually comfortable. Since the treatment doesn’t involve surgery or injections, there is no risk of infection or scarring.
Who Should Try LLLT?
LLLT is best for:
- Men and women with early hair thinning
- People who want to avoid surgery
- Those looking for a painless treatment
- People who are already using other hair treatments and want to boost results
However, it may not be ideal for people with complete baldness or severe hair loss, since there may not be enough active follicles left to stimulate.
